Description

NGC 1342 is an open cluster located in the constellation Perseus.

It was discovered by German-British astronomer William Herschel in 1799. NGC 1342 is located approximately 2,090 light-years from the solar system, and the latest estimates give an age of 460 million years. The apparent diameter of the cluster is about 10.7 light-years.

According to the classification of open clusters of Robert Trumpler, this cluster contains less than 50 stars.
